About This Data

This page shows how Nissan 350z cars manufactured in 2006 perform at MOT as they age. Data spans from 2009 to 2016, covering 326 tests. Pass rates naturally decline with age as components wear.

Based on DVSA anonymised MOT test data (2005–2024). Crown copyright, Open Government Licence v3.0.
